The camp offers a comprehensive introduction to cybersecurity principles through hands-on activities and live online instruction, taught by talented instructors with a low student-to-teacher ratio.
Students at Lavner Education's Virtual Cybersecurity Coding Summer Camp will delve into the critical world of digital security. The curriculum focuses on practical skills and knowledge, covering essential topics such as understanding various cyber threats (hacking, phishing, malware), implementing network security measures to protect sensitive information, and exploring cryptography for encrypting and decrypting messages. Campers will also learn digital forensics to investigate cybercrimes and gain an introduction to ethical hacking to identify system vulnerabilities. Through hands-on activities and live online instruction, participants will develop a solid understanding of cybersecurity principles and acquire valuable skills to safeguard themselves and others from online dangers. The camp aims to foster curiosity about the evolving cybersecurity landscape and inspire continued learning in new technologies.
Each camp session meets Monday through Friday for 3 hours per day, featuring all-live, online instruction and collaboration.
This camp is ideal for middle school students (ages 10-14) who are curious about how to protect digital systems and interested in learning about cyber threats, ethical hacking, and data security.
